Maison >Tutoriel CMS >EmpireCMS >Solution à l'erreur d'actualisation de la liste personnalisée lors de la mise à niveau d'Imperial CMS vers 7.0

Solution à l'erreur d'actualisation de la liste personnalisée lors de la mise à niveau d'Imperial CMS vers 7.0

王林
王林original
2019-11-06 17:19:072929parcourir

Solution à l'erreur d'actualisation de la liste personnalisée lors de la mise à niveau d'Imperial CMS vers 7.0

Description du problème :

La condition vérifiée = 1 sera utilisée lors de la création de listes personnalisées dans empire cms6.6. Après la mise à niveau, actualisez. la liste personnalisée Une erreur se produira, indiquant que le champ coché n'existe pas.

Cause du problème :

Empire cms7.0 ne définit plus le champ coché dans la table principale, et les informations auditées et non auditées sont stockées dans des tables séparées.

Solution :

Modifiez la liste personnalisée et supprimez la condition cochée=1. Si vous configurez de nombreuses listes personnalisées, vous pouvez envisager un remplacement par lots par des instructions SQL, telles que :

update `zhuxianfeicom_enewsuserlist` set totalsql=replace(totalsql,'and checked=1',''),listsql=replace(listsql,'
and checked=1','')

Tutoriel recommandé : Tutoriel Empire CMS

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n